Abstract Objective: Although some studies have examined the association between eating behaviour and elevated blood pressure (EBP) in adolescents, current data on the association between sugar-sweetened beverages (SSB) and EBP in adolescents in Yunnan Province, China, are lacking. Setting: Cluster sampling was used to survey freshmen at a college in Kunming, Yunnan Province, from November to December. Data on SSB consumption were collected using an FFQ measuring height, weight and blood pressure. A logistic regression model was used to analyse the association between SSB consumption and EBP, encompassing prehypertension and hypertension with sex-specific analyses. Participants: The analysis included 4781 college students. Results: Elevated systolic blood pressure (SBP) and diastolic blood pressure (DBP) were detected in 35·10 % (1678/4781) and 39·34 % (1881/4781) of patients, respectively. After adjusting for confounding variables, tea beverage consumption was associated with elevated SBP (OR = 1·24, 95 % CI: 1·03, 1·49, P = 0·024), and carbonated beverage (OR = 1·23, 95 % CI: 1·04, 1·45, P = 0·019) and milk beverage (OR = 0·81, 95 % CI: 0·69, 0·95, P = 0·010) consumption was associated with elevated DBP in college students. Moreover, fruit beverage (OR = 1·32, 95 % CI: 1·00, 1·75, P = 0·048) and milk beverage consumption (OR = 0·69, 95 % CI: 0·52, 0·93, P = 0·014) was associated with elevated DBP in males. Conclusion: Our findings indicated that fruit and milk beverage consumption was associated with elevated DBP in males, and no association was observed with EBP in females.
